Date: January 25, 1945 - Size: Small - Location: Clark Field, 63 kilometers northwest of Manila, Central Luzon Island, Philippines

Intended for Solo Play as Allies vs. AI

Scenario Briefing:The US 160th Regimental Combat Team was tasked with taking Lafe Hill along with several other hills nearby. Lafe Hill had a cliff to its immediate front so Hill 500 was chosen as the first objective. Once the 160th RCT had taken that feature then they could branch out and take Lafe Hill and the rest of the defensive positions.

Defending on the hill were elements of the Takayama Detachment. Supporting them was two batteries of artillery. The Allies had airpower to help them with the attack.

The 160th's fight was difficult but by the end of the 26th they had cleared the hills and along with the 108th RCT they were ready to advance to the west and south and take Clark Field.
